Eurylochus | EpicTheMusical Wiki | Fandom
Although she is never mentioned in the musical, according to Homer, Eurylochus had a wife, Ctimene, who was Odysseus' youngest sister. Thus, Eurylochus is his captain's brother-in-law.

Ctimene | Myths of the World Wiki | Fandom
Ctimene (or Ktimene) was the younger sister of Odysseus, the legendaryGreek king of Ithaca, and daughter of Laërtes and Anticlea, who raised her alongside the servant Eumaeus, who was …
